Yep... Caldwell missed on Blake and the whole 2013 draft. He's about .500 on free agents. But he does well in mid rounds it seems (Shack Harris 2.0?)
Coughlin (as overseer) seemingly doubled down on Blake, drafted a RB that doesn't mesh with the QB's style (shotgun vs under center), and then took depth on the DL when we needed OL.
Plenty of blame to go around.

^^ I think that is often forgotten.  We had previous stats that Bortles does better when the first play is a pass.  Can he run a play action scheme?  Yeah they botched it for sure but the stubborn traits are everywhere.

1. Rules favor pass blocking and holding calls are down...  Jaguars let's get road graders who plod against edge rushers
2. Rules favor offense over defense... Jaguars let's build a quality defense and draft for depth
3. NFL is a Quick Pass and Run to setup the pass league... Jaguars let's get a guy that can't get rid of the ball or make quick decisions

We are running counter to any type of wisdom.  Honestly I like old school but the league has legislated against it.
